前言Scrapy是一个非常好的抓取框架,它不仅提供了一些开箱可用的基础组建,还能够根据自己的需求,进行强大的自定义。本文主要给大家介绍了关于Python抓取框架Scrapy之页面提取的相关内容,分享出来供大家参考学习,下面随着小编来一起学习学习吧。下面创建一个爬虫项目,以图虫网为例抓取图片。一、内容分析打开 图虫网,顶部菜单“发现” “标签”里面是对各种图片的分类,点击一个标签,比如“美女”,网页
用JavaScript获取页面元素常见的三种方法:                             &
转载 2023-06-15 23:31:41
149阅读
其他的框架比如htmlparser 之类都是要建立正则表达,或是建立parse tree 来解析web页面。对于页面中有噪音(比如多余的无关的字符。诸如回车,这样的解析就不很方便 )   。 python自身带的html处理函数 ,个人感觉不太方便。 所以直
转载 2023-05-28 21:57:17
172阅读
1. 事件修饰符Vue中事件修饰符 事件的执行阶段:捕获阶段(父元素) --> 事件源阶段(被点击的内部子元素) --> 事件冒泡阶段 1. stop 阻止冒泡 如: <div id="inner" @click="innerClick"> <input type="button" value="按钮
# Python 抓取 Vue 页面数据 在现代的 Web 开发中,Vue.js 成为了非常流行的前端框架之一。Vue.js 是一个基于 JavaScript 的开源框架,用于构建用户界面。在一些情况下,我们可能需要使用 Python抓取 Vue 页面数据,以进行后续的分析或处理。本文将介绍如何使用 Python 抓取 Vue 页面数据,并提供示例代码。 ## 1. 安装必要的库 在开
原创 2023-07-18 14:59:27
1063阅读
使用JavaScript在网页中提取数据 1.F12打开开发者工具
转载 2023-05-29 17:57:47
71阅读
随着越来越多的网站开始用JS在客户端浏览器动态渲染网站,导致很多我们需要的数据并不能由原始的html中获取,再加上Scrapy本身并不提供JS渲染解析的功能,通常对这类网站数据的爬取我们一般采用两种方法:通过分析网站,找到对应数据的接口,模拟接口去获取我们需要的数据(参见Scrapy抓取Ajax动态页面),但是一旦该网站的接口隐藏的很深,或者接口的加密过于复杂,此种方法可能就有点行不通了借助JS内
使用正则抓取使用正则匹配需要抓取的内容执行页面抓取。但是正则性能不好,如果一个正则匹配稍有差池,那可能程序就处在永久的循环之中。#coding=utf-8 import urllib.request #python3 import re def getHtml(url): page = urllib.request.urlopen(url) #python3 html=page.
Python3网络爬虫基本操作(二):静态网页抓取一.前言二.静态网页抓取1.安装Requests库2.获取网页相应内容3.定制Requests(1)Get请求(2)定制请求头(3)超时三.项目实践1.网站分析2.信息获取3.储存数据 一.前言Python版本:Python3.X 运行环境:Windows IDE:PyCharm经过上一篇博客,相信大家对爬虫有一定认识了,这一篇我们系统的来讲解一
# 使用 Python 抓取小程序页面数据的完整指南 在互联网高速发展的时代,抓取网页数据的技能显得尤为重要。本文将教你如何使用 Python 抓取小程序页面数据。过程虽然复杂,但只要遵循以下步骤,就能轻松实现。 ## 工作流程 以下表格展示了整个流程的主要步骤: | 步骤 | 描述 | |--------------|---
原创 8月前
104阅读
本代码使用的是python3.x方法一:通过运行python,自动打开网页,并抓取该网页。前提:先安装驱动,然后运行即可。详情请查看上一篇文章import os from selenium import webdriver browser = webdriver.Chrome()#打开网页 browser.get("https://einvoice.taobao.com/index?&_
  相信所有个人网站的站长都有抓取别人数据的经历吧,目前抓取别人网站数据的方式无非两种方式:  一、使用第三方工具,其中最著名的是火车头采集器,在此不做介绍。  二、自己写程序抓取,这种方式要求站长自己写程序,可能对对站长的开发能力有所要求了。  本人起初也曾试着用第三方的工具抓取我所需要的数据,由于网上的流行的第三方工具不是不符合我的要求,就是过
转载 2024-08-27 13:59:13
183阅读
# 如何实现Python抓取延迟响应数据页面 作为一名经验丰富的开发者,我将向你介绍如何实现Python抓取延迟响应数据页面。这个过程可以分为以下几个步骤: ## 流程步骤表格 ```mermaid graph LR A(开始) --> B(发送请求) B --> C(等待响应) C --> D(解析数据) D --> E(结束) ``` ## 每一步的具体操作 1. **发送请求*
原创 2024-04-28 03:21:20
38阅读
效果预览 思路1、首先我们打开拉勾网,并搜索“java”,显示出来的职位信息就是我们的目标。2、接下来我们需要确定,怎样将信息提取出来。查看网页源代码,这时候发现,网页源代码里面找不到职位相关信息,这证明拉勾网关于职位的信息是异步加载的,这也是一种很常用的技术。异步加载的信息,我们需要借助 chrome 浏览器的开发者工具进行分析,打开开发者工具的方法如下:点击Nerwork进入网络分析界面,这
# 如何使用 Python 抓取钉钉页面数据 在网络开发中,我们常常需要从网站上抓取数据,以便进行进一步的数据分析和处理。对于刚入行的开发者来说,抓取数据的过程可能会显得有些复杂。今天,我将带你一步一步地实现“使用 Python 抓取钉钉的页面数据”。 ## 整体流程 在开始之前,我们先了解一下整个项目的基本流程。以下是我们的步骤: | 步骤 | 描述
原创 8月前
134阅读
# Python抓取豆瓣新片榜页面数据 豆瓣是一个非常著名的电影评价和推荐网站,每天都会有很多用户在上面评价和推荐电影。而豆瓣的新片榜单是很多影迷关注的焦点,我们可以通过Python抓取豆瓣新片榜页面数据,以便进行分析或者展示。 ## 1. 网页抓取 首先,我们需要使用Python的`requests`库来发送HTTP请求,并获得豆瓣新片榜页面的HTML源代码。下面是一个简单的示例代码:
原创 2023-08-24 19:25:40
1175阅读
1. 特点 在python 解析html这篇文章中已经做了初步的介绍,接下来再坐进一步的说明。python抓取页面信息有下面两个特点: 依赖于HTML的架构。 微小的变化可能会导致抓取失败,这取决于你编码的技巧。 2. 抓取演示样例 首先看一下百度视频网页的源码,大致浏览下,选定要抓取的网页元素。
转载 2017-07-31 14:47:00
139阅读
# Python抓取页面信息的步骤和代码解析 ## 1. 介绍 在网络爬虫和数据分析的过程中,经常需要从网页上获取特定的信息。Python是一种功能强大且易于使用的编程语言,非常适合用于抓取页面信息。本文将介绍用Python实现页面信息抓取的步骤和相应的代码。 ## 2. 整体流程 下面是实现Python抓取页面信息的整体流程: | 步骤 | 描述 | | --- | --- | | 步骤1
原创 2023-08-14 17:24:03
98阅读
# 学习如何使用 Python 抓取页面 Session 在网络爬虫的世界中,抓取页面的过程涉及到许多步骤,特别是在处理需要会话(Session)管理的页面时。对于新手来说,可能会感到复杂,但只要你掌握了基本流程和相应的代码,就能顺利进行。 ## 过程概述 以下是抓取网页 Session 的基本流程: | 步骤 | 描述 | |------|------| | 1 | 导入必要的库
原创 2024-09-29 03:29:19
41阅读
# Python Selenium 页面抓取教程 ## 导言 在本教程中,我们将学习如何使用 Python Selenium 库来进行页面抓取。Selenium 是一个自动化测试工具,它可以模拟用户在浏览器中的操作,同时也可以用于页面抓取。在本教程中,我们将使用 Selenium WebDriver 来实现页面抓取,并且以 Python 为编程语言。 ## 流程图 | 步骤 | 说明 | |
原创 2023-07-19 14:57:32
111阅读
  • 1
  • 2
  • 3
  • 4
  • 5